Auch wenn sie bei Standardtakt noch abstürzt, kann es trotzdem am OC liegen. Schließlich wird Mad-Moxx die Karte mit mehr Spannung versehen, um höhere Taktraten stabil zu erriechen. Evtl. schlägt der Überhitzungsschutz hier einfach zu früh an.
Wie warm ist es denn ansonsten in deinem Gehäuse?
Wenn es lediglich bei diesen zwei Spielen zu Problemen kommt, heißt es auf Patches warten. ;)
